This property is located in Little Hayfield, High Peak, a quiet village in Derbyshire that lies within the basin of the River Sett and is a few miles from nearby towns.
Little Hayfield, High Peak is a small village in Derbyshire, England, within the High Peak district. It is part of the civil parish of Hayfield and has a population of around 2,700. The village is situated 3 miles east of New Mills, 4.5 miles south of Glossop, and 10 miles north of Buxton, all within the basin of the River Sett. The area is rural, with a setting that is typical of the Derbyshire countryside. The locality is part of the SK 22 postal district and is characterised by its village setting and proximity to nearby towns and natural features.
